Output e8a52065fc20cd9f125f9a0872a3635fe820ef7ee16c5f441eb1f90db88a8b15:3

value
185208181
script pubkey
OP_0 OP_PUSHBYTES_20 3bd95ab8a7801ea0a88bba018d9b50b7786896e8
address
ltc1q80v44w98sq02p2ythgqcmx6skaux39hg3e7rkm
transaction
e8a52065fc20cd9f125f9a0872a3635fe820ef7ee16c5f441eb1f90db88a8b15
spent
true